Organic, Biodynamic, and Natural Winemaking: A Brief Overview

Organic, biodynamic, and natural winemaking philosophies all share a common thread of sustainability, respect for nature, and minimal intervention. Organic winemaking prioritizes the cultivation of grapes without the use of synthetic chemicals, promoting soil health and biodiversity. Biodynamic winemaking extends this approach by incorporating spiritual and cosmic influences, often utilizing herbal and mineral preparations to enhance vineyard vitality. Natural winemaking takes minimal intervention to the extreme, advocating for spontaneous fermentation with native yeast and eschewing additives.

The Role of Yeast in Winemaking

Yeast is a microorganism that naturally occurs on grape skins and in winery environments. Its primary role in winemaking is to convert sugars present in grape juice into alcohol and carbon dioxide through fermentation. This process not only imparts the alcoholic content to the wine but also shapes its aromatic and flavor profile. Yeast achieves this through anaerobic respiration, breaking down sugars into ethanol and releasing heat as a byproduct.

Yeast also influences the wine’s secondary characteristics, such as its aroma, flavor, and mouthfeel. Different yeast strains produce varying amounts of byproducts like esters, aldehydes, and phenols, which contribute to the wine’s bouquet. These nuances can greatly enhance the sensory experience of the final product, showcasing the unique identity of the grape variety and the terroir.

Yeast Selection for Organic, Biodynamic, and Natural Wines

In conventional winemaking, commercial yeast strains are often used to ensure a consistent and controlled fermentation process. However, in the realms of organic, biodynamic, and natural winemaking, reliance on indigenous yeast strains is a hallmark. Indigenous or wild yeast refers to the microorganisms naturally present in the vineyard and winery environment. They may come from the grape skins, the air, or the equipment.

Utilizing indigenous yeast contributes to the authenticity and uniqueness of the wine. These strains are well-adapted to the specific terroir and can express its characteristics more vividly. However, this approach comes with challenges. Indigenous yeast fermentation can be less predictable and more susceptible to stuck fermentations, where the yeast activity halts prematurely.

Managing Indigenous Yeast Fermentations

Managing indigenous yeast fermentations requires finesse and a keen understanding of the process. Winemakers often use techniques such as cold soaking, whole-cluster fermentation, and extended maceration to encourage the growth of desirable native yeast strains. Monitoring temperature, nutrient levels, and oxygen exposure is crucial to ensure a successful fermentation.

In some cases, winemakers may choose to use a pied de cuve, a small starter culture of indigenous yeast, to kickstart fermentation. This can mitigate the risk of a stuck fermentation and promote a healthier fermentation process.

Benefits and Challenges

The use of indigenous yeast in organic, biodynamic, and natural winemaking has several benefits:

  1. Terroir Expression: Indigenous yeast strains reflect the unique character of the vineyard, contributing to a wine that is a true expression of its origin.
  2. Complexity: Wild yeast fermentations often lead to more complex aromas and flavors, enhancing the wine’s overall quality.
  3. Sustainability: Reliance on indigenous yeast reduces the need for commercial yeast production, aligning with the sustainable principles of these winemaking philosophies.

However, there are also challenges associated with indigenous yeast fermentation:

  1. Risk of Stuck Fermentations: Indigenous yeast can be less robust than commercial strains, leading to the potential for stuck or sluggish fermentations.
  2. Inconsistency: Fermentations driven by indigenous yeast can be less predictable, potentially resulting in variations between vintages.
  3. Time and Patience: Wild yeast fermentations often require more time to complete compared to fermentations using commercial yeast strains.
